Job description

The Bragg Group of Companies is a diverse international corporate group with its head office in Oxford, Nova Scotia, operating primarily in Canada and the United States. The Group has over 6,000 employees in diverse industries including telecommunications, food manufacturing and agriculture, aviation services, real estate, renewable power production and portfolio investment. We are seeking a tax professional to join our corporate tax team and be responsible for managing the tax function for the entire Group. As part of this team, you will report to the Senior Manager of Finance & Taxation.

Responsibilities:
  • Manage income taxation across the Group, including Canadian tax compliance, installments, research, and audit coordination.
  • Work directly with our accounting teams in preparing annual tax provisions and cash tax forecasts.
  • Collaborate with our operational teams in transaction reviews and contribute to other planning initiatives.
Qualifications:
  • A CPA designation, along with a minimum of 2 years’ experience in corporate tax.
  • Enrolled in or completed the CPA Canada In-depth Tax Course or equivalent.
  • Exposure to US corporate and cross border tax issues would be an asset.
Skills and Attributes:
  •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, flexibility, and a hands-on approach.
  • Advanced computer literacy and skills, with proficiency in Tax Prep software.
  • Energy with a keen interest in learning about our businesses.
  • Take charge attitude with a problem-solving mindset.
  • Proactive towards emerging business issues, using collaborative approaches.
  • Ability to thoughtfully research tax issues and communicate results with advisors and management.
